What does a data entry operator do?

A Data Entry Operator is responsible for inputting, updating, and maintaining information in computer systems and databases. They ensure that the data is accurate, complete, and entered in a timely manner. Typical duties include typing information from physical documents or digital files, verifying data for errors, and sometimes performing basic data analysis. Data Entry Operators play a crucial role in helping organizations keep their records organized and accessible.

What are some common challenges data entry operators face, and how can they overcome them?

Data Entry Operators often encounter challenges such as repetitive tasks, tight deadlines, and maintaining high accuracy under pressure. To overcome these, it's important to develop strong organizational habits, take regular breaks to avoid fatigue, and utilize keyboard shortcuts to boost efficiency. Staying detail-oriented and double-checking work can help minimize errors, while open communication with supervisors ensures priorities are clear and support is available when needed.

What You'll Do
In this role, you'll prepare and maintain accurate legal birth and death records, birth certificates, and other required documentation while ensuring compliance with state and local regulations. You'll work closely with patients, families, physicians, the Health Department, and other hospital departments to collect information, explain required forms, notarize documents, and ensure records are completed correctly. You'll also handle data entry, statistical reporting, phone calls, filing, supply management, and other clerical responsibilities to keep the Mother Baby department running smoothly. Above all, you'll provide professional, compassionate service while maintaining confidentiality, accuracy, and a positive experience for patients and their families.
Job Responsibilities
  • Prepare and maintain accurate birth and death records in accordance with state and local requirements.
  • Review patient charts and interview patients and families to gather information for legal records.
  • Explain paternity affidavits, rights and responsibilities, and other required documentation to patients.
  • Notarize signatures on paternity affidavits and ensure all documents are completed correctly.
  • Enter, proofread, and verify information on birth and death certificates for accuracy.
  • Distribute birth records, certificates, affidavits, and other required documents to appropriate departments and agencies.
  • Complete data entry, maintain department logs and records, and organize confidential documentation.
  • Prepare monthly, quarterly, and annual statistical reports using departmental data.
  • Communicate professionally with patients, families, physicians, hospital staff, funeral homes, and the Health Department.
  • Perform general administrative duties, including answering phones, filing, photocopying, managing supplies, and processing mail.
